    Pope Francis on Saturday met with aid workers and rescue dogs that were deployed after the earthquake in Italy. The pope received a team of rescue workers at the St. Peter's Square, the Italian news agency ANSA reported. Here he petted the dog, Leo, who had taken away a girl alive under the rubble with his team.

    Thousands of Kurds or Germans of Kurdish origin have sat on the right bank of the Rhine in Cologne collected for a large demonstration against the policies of the Turkish President Erdogan. The Turkish president would always act more like a dictator, especially after the failed coup attempt in July. The protesters also demand the withdrawal of Turkish attacks on Kurdish Syrians militias in northern Syria.

    A wildfire in a mountain pass in the southern US state of California has put about a hundred homes in ashes. Tens of thousands of people were forced to seek refuge. Since the fire broke out in the so-called Blue Cut Tuesday, nearly 15,000 hectares of bone-dry scrub went up in flames.

    Police in Rio de Janeiro in view of the Olympic Games from Sunday, received the support of 22,000 men of the Brazilian Armed Forces. In total, rounding the 51,600 men and women of the police and the army out to ensure the safety of the city and the Games.

    Spanish police and military have been using four helicopters evacuated 174 people who were isolated hit in the far west of the island of Tenerife. The evacuees had to leave their cars, because the reason for their plight was the collapse of a portion of a mountain road, Spanish media reported Wednesday.
